Gishanda Fish Farm is a community-based enterprise, run by Akagera Management Company Ltd (AMC Ltd), farming and harvesting fish products using a Recirculating Aquaculture System. The farm will operate to produce and process fish and fry on site for sales locally and nationally.

Akagera Management Company Ltd was created as a partnership between Rwanda Development Board (RDB) and African Parks Network (APN) to manage Akagera National Park and its complementary community enterprises.
